I drew the Frigate Bird. In many ways, this is the ultimate bird of the air; with the largest wingspan to body ratio of any bird, they can literally remain in the air for over a week at a time. They are known as pirates and thieves because they often steal prey from other birds, but this is actually only a small part of their diet.
